#202335 Color Information

#202335 is a dark color. The closest websafe version is #202335. A complement of this color would be #363321, perceived brightness is 0.14, and the grayscale version is #2B2B2B.

In the HSL color space, this color has a hue angle of 231°,a saturation of 25%, and a lightness of 17%.The HSV representation shows a hue of 231°, a saturation of 40%, and a value of 21%.

In a RGB color space, #202335 is composed of 13% red, 14% green and 21%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 40% cyan, 34% magenta, 0% yellow and 79% black.

In the Yxy color space, this color is represented as Y: 1.74, x: 0.2859, and y: 0.2780.
